While driving along a road in Loire-Atlantique on 11 June 1994, a witness spotted a lemon-sized object fitted with multiple lights and a cable on top. When the driver slowed to about 20 km/h, the object kept pace as if following the car. Upon being reached, it duplicated itself without changing shape or size, then accelerated sharply, turned right, flew over a wood, and shot straight up at remarkable speed. The entire episode was silent and lasted several minutes. GEIPAN classified the case as D — no conventional explanation could account for the observation, and the object's identity and origin remain unknown.
